The popular Yoruba freedom fighter, Chief Sunday Adeyemo— Sunday Igboho alongside scores of youths under the umbrella of Omo Oduduwa United, on Saturday, stormed Osogbo, Osun State despite threat of Police to agitate for the Yoruba Nation.
According to reports, security operatives had took over the Nelson Mandela Freedom Park where the rally was supposed to be held.
This development however forced the Yoruba Nation agitators to move the November 27 Bridge, around Neco Office, Africa area, Osogbo where they later converged for the movement.
Igboho alongside other agitators covered many streets and distances preaching the gospel of the Yoruba Nation. They carried placards, cardboard and chanted seccesion songs as they march from streets to streets
